Which is more popular, literary fiction or fantasy fiction?
It depends on different factors. Among certain academic and literary - minded circles, literary fiction might be more popular as it is often studied and analyzed. However, in the general reading public, especially among younger readers, fantasy fiction has a large following. Fantasy series like 'Harry Potter' have a global appeal that reaches a vast audience. So, it's hard to simply say which one is more popular overall.

What are the characteristics of literary fantasy fiction?
Literary fantasy fiction often has richly imagined worlds. It can include elements like magic, mythical creatures, and alternate realities. For example, in 'The Lord of the Rings', Tolkien created a vast Middle - earth filled with elves, dwarves, and magic rings. These works usually also have complex characters with deep emotions and moral dilemmas.

What are the main differences between literary fiction and fantasy fiction?
Literary fiction often focuses on realistic characters and situations, exploring complex human emotions and relationships in a more down - to - earth way. Fantasy fiction, on the other hand, involves elements like magic, mythical creatures, and otherworldly settings. For example, 'Pride and Prejudice' is literary fiction that delves into social hierarchies and love in 19th - century England, while 'The Lord of the Rings' is fantasy with hobbits, wizards, and epic battles in Middle - earth.

What are the key differences in 'fiction vs fiction'?
The themes are distinct in 'fiction vs fiction'. A mystery fiction's main theme is often solving a crime or a puzzle, while a romance fiction focuses on love and relationships. The pacing is another factor. Thriller fictions usually have a fast - paced plot to keep the readers on the edge of their seats, whereas literary fictions might have a more leisurely pace to allow for deeper exploration of ideas and emotions.

What are the key elements in fantasy literary fiction?
Well, in fantasy literary fiction, one important element is the hero's journey. The protagonist usually starts from an ordinary life and then is thrust into extraordinary adventures. They face challenges and grow throughout the story. And the use of symbolism is also common. Symbols can represent deeper meanings, like the white witch in 'The Chronicles of Narnia' symbolizing evil. And of course, there's the element of the unknown. Fantasy often explores uncharted territories, be it new lands or new forms of magic.

What is the difference between fantasy and literary fiction?
Fantasy often involves elements that don't exist in the real world, like magic, mythical creatures, and otherworldly settings. Literary fiction, on the other hand, focuses more on character development, complex human relationships, and exploring real - life themes in a more down - to - earth way. Fantasy may take readers on an adventure to a far - flung magical land, while literary fiction might stay closer to home but dig deep into the human psyche.
